PyCharm中切换Python版本详解
1. 引言
PyCharm是一款由JetBrains开发的集成开发环境(IDE),专门用于Python开发。对于使用PyCharm进行Python开发的开发者来说,切换Python版本是非常重要的。本文将详解PyCharm中如何切换Python版本。
2. 为什么需要切换Python版本?
在Python的发展过程中,有很多版本的Python被发布出来。每个版本可能存在一些差异、改进或错误修复,这意味着在不同的项目中可能需要使用不同的Python版本。此外,一些库或框架对特定的Python版本有依赖,因此在开发中,可能需要在不同的版本之间进行切换。
3. 安装多个Python版本
在切换Python版本之前,我们需要在PyCharm中安装多个Python版本。PyCharm为我们提供了一个简便的方式来安装和管理Python版本。
首先,在PyCharm的设置中打开“Project Interpreter”页面。在这个页面中,我们可以查看和管理当前项目的Python解释器。
然后,点击右上角的“Add”按钮,将会打开一个窗口,显示可用的Python解释器。在这个窗口中,我们可以选择从系统中已经安装好的Python版本,或者通过连接PyCharm的Python安装器来安装其他版本。
点击“System Interpreter”选项卡,我们可以选择已经在系统中安装好的Python版本。
点击“Virtualenv Environment”选项卡,我们可以选择通过连接PyCharm的Python安装器来安装其他版本。
4. 切换Python版本
一旦我们在PyCharm中安装了多个Python版本,就可以进行版本之间的切换。
在PyCharm的设置中打开“Project Interpreter”页面,并选择需要切换到的Python解释器。点击“OK”按钮保存设置。
此时,我们已经成功切换到新的Python版本。我们可以在PyCharm中运行和调试项目,使用新的Python版本。
5. 示例代码
下面是一个简单的示例代码,演示了如何在PyCharm中切换Python版本。
import sys
print("当前Python版本:", sys.version)
if sys.version_info.major == 3:
print("这是Python 3版本")
else:
print("这是Python 2版本")
在PyCharm中,我们可以通过切换Python版本来运行这段代码。这个示例代码会打印当前使用的Python版本,并根据版本号输出不同的信息。你可以尝试在不同的Python版本下运行这段代码,看看输出结果是否有所不同。
当前Python版本: 3.9.1 (default, Jan 25 2021, 13:36:39)
[GCC 8.3.0]
这是Python 3版本
6. 总结
在本文中,我们详细介绍了如何在PyCharm中切换Python版本。首先,我们需要安装多个Python版本,并在PyCharm中进行配置。然后,我们可以通过在PyCharm的设置中选择Python解释器来切换Python版本。最后,我们通过一个示例代码演示了如何在PyCharm中切换Python版本并运行代码。
通过PyCharm的强大功能,我们可以轻松地在多个Python版本之间进行切换,以满足不同项目的需求。